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the Van Winkler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Van Winkler Cemetery:
39.3791, -95.0345
The Van Winkler Cemetery is located in Leavenworth County<1>.
The county seat for Leavenworth County is located in Leavenworth. Leavenworth lies just to the southeast of the Van Winkler Cemetery .

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#478267 (Van Winkler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#478267 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Leavenworth
- Est. Elev: 340 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Oak Mills
- Location given for Van Winkler Cemetery:
- Lat: 39.379165 Lon: -95.034688
